Next Volvo XC90 Rumors
The Volvo XC90 has been on the market since 2002, so saying that the Swedish SUV needs a replacement would be a major understatement. The carmaker is well aware of this and is working to give us a new model, but this is not expected to arrive soon.

The next XC90 will be the first Volvo to use the carmaker’s Scalable Platfrom Architecture (SPA), which will also be found under the next XC60, S60, V70 and S80, with power set to come from the automaker’s fresh four-cylinder VEA (Volvo Environmental Architecture), which should be an example of downsizing. Volvo is expected to also offer a hybrid version alongside the typical petrol and diesel ones.

In other Volvo-related news, the company is expected to expand its crossover range by launching an XC30, which will be slotted under the upcoming XC40, with the vehicle set to arrive by the middle of the decade.

Rumour: High Performance Polestar Volvo S60
This news is still in a very early stage but, we’re told told that Volvo might we be working on a high performance version of the Volvo S60. If the rumours are true, this car can will be pitched as a competitor for the BMW M3, Mercedes-Benz C63 AMG and Audi RS4.

What is for sure is that Volvo has a good base to build a car for this segment. We are, of course, talking about the C30 performance concept car that had an output of 405 hp. Polestar Performance will have a hand in the build process of this car. 

More rumours suggest that the powerful S60 could use the 4.4 liter V8 engine that we saw before in the Noble M600. In the Noble, this produces a stunning 650 hp. If Volvo is planning to use that engine we might see a totally different car than a simple competitor for the BWM or Mercedes-Benz. Official release is expected late 2013.
